Output 8ac23e61f50481332af5cb833045e7571f8e9a29ad07cd7231c9f6d515759ce6:1

value
459335306
script pubkey
OP_0 OP_PUSHBYTES_20 3c5d1ca61b75976edf4ceb9c895780e61e7747f3
address
bc1q83w3efsmwktkah6vawwgj4uquc08w3lna27f04
transaction
8ac23e61f50481332af5cb833045e7571f8e9a29ad07cd7231c9f6d515759ce6